PETAR JELIĆ: MILAN WOULD BE PROUD OF WHAT WE ARE DOING FOR REPUBLIKA SRPSKA

MODRIČA, JANUARY 5 /SRNA/ - On the occasion of Republic Day, January 9, wreaths were laid today in Modriča at the monument to former President of Republika Srpska Milan Jelić, and his son Petar emphasized that after his father's death a void remained, but also pride in everything he had accomplished.

"He is missed, especially during holidays when he should have been with his family. Life is like that. We must go on, and we know that he would have wanted it that way. I believe he would be proud of what he did, but also of what we are now doing for Republika Srpska," said Jelić, who is also an SNSD member of the National Assembly of Republika Srpska. He expressed gratitude to the officials of Republika Srpska who laid wreaths today at the monument to his father in Modriča. "A great void has remained for us, but also the pride and dignity that he created during his lifetime and left to us as a legacy," Jelić said. The Minister of Labour and Veterans' and Disability Protection of Republika Srpska Danijel Egić and the Minister of Justice Goran Selak laid a wreath today, on the occasion of Republic Day, at the memorial to former President of Republika Srpska Milan Jelić. Milan Jelić was born in 1956 and passed away on September 30, 2007. He was the sixth President of Republika Srpska, a businessman, and a politician. Jelić was also a university professor, a Doctor of Economic Sciences, and a sports official from Republika Srpska, as well as President of the Football Associations of BiH and Republika Srpska.
